Puma White Hunter help

Has anyone tried sharpening a white hunter one the WEP. I have one on the way and was worried about all of the irregular angles on the blade. It doesn’t look like there is anywhere to clamp the blade except at the base. I was thinking about trying the tormek small knife jig and clamping using the handle. the other thing that worries me, is the angle of the edge. Im not sure it is the same all the way down the blade.

i have had good results with the Tormek SVM-00 small knife jig.

Looks to me that the knife may be to big for the Tormek adapter, but maybe not. Of the photos I see on the Puma web site, it looks like there is a flat area just above the belly, which is where I’d try first. Maybe even mount the knife so that it points upward at some angle to find a sweet spot.
